Indore – Hazrat Nizamuddin Express

The Indore – Hazrat Nizamuddin Express (Hindi:इन्दौर - हज़रत निज़ामुद्दीन एक्सप्रेस, Urdu:حضرت نظام الدّین اندور ایکسپری , Punjabi:ਇੰਦੌਰ - ਹਜਰਤ ਨਿਜ਼ਾਮੁਦ੍ਦੀਨ ਏਕ੍ਸਪ੍ਰੇਸ), commonly "Indore Intercity Express" is a daily super fast train service which runs between Indore Junction railway station of Indore, the largest city and commercial hub of Central Indian state Madhya Pradesh and Hazrat Nizamuddin railway station of Delhi, the capital city of India. This train is the only lengthy train from Indore, having a total of 24 Coaches and is the most preferable choice of the Indore people to reach Delhi.

Average speed and frequency

The train runs on daily basis from both the cities with an average speed of 71 km/h. which makes it the fastest train originating from Indore. It reaches Delhi before time i.e. within 11-12 hrs. as compared to other trains from Indore to or via. Delhi.
